feat(lang): basic formatting
Adds support for formatting some elements without any indentation.
Mostly for testing model serialization with some human-readable
formatting instead of just space-separating the tokens.
Finishing the formatter to support all language constructs might be a
bit more difficult due to our Prolog-like indentation rules.
